区块链技术,这个听起来有点高大上的名词,近年来在科技圈备受关注,它到底是什么意思呢?我们又该如何开户参与其中呢?我就来为大家揭秘区块链技术的神秘面纱,以及区块链开发的具体内容。
让我们来了解一下区块链技术是什么意思,区块链技术是一种去中心化的分布式数据库技术,它通过密码学原理,将数据进行加密处理,再以链式结构存储起来,这种技术具有去中心化、不可篡改、公开透明等特点,由于这些特点,区块链技术被广泛应用于数字货币、供应链管理、物联网、版权保护等领域。
如何开户参与区块链呢?这里所说的“开户”主要是指创建一个数字货币钱包,以下是一个简单的开户流程:
1、选择一个可靠的数字货币钱包,目前市面上有很多种数字货币钱包,如比特币钱包、以太坊钱包等,在选择钱包时,要考虑到安全性、易用性等因素。
2、下载并安装数字货币钱包,根据所选钱包的提示,下载相应的客户端,并按照指引完成安装。
3、创建钱包账户,打开钱包客户端,按照提示创建一个新账户,这个过程可能需要设置密码、备份私钥等操作,务必妥善保管好相关信息。
4、获取数字货币,开户完成后,你可以通过交易所、场外交易等方式,购买或兑换数字货币。
5、发起交易,在钱包中,你可以进行收款、转账等操作,只需输入对方的钱包地址,即可完成交易。
我们再来了解一下区块链开发是什么,区块链开发主要是指开发基于区块链技术的应用,包括但不限于数字货币、智能合约、去中心化应用(DApp)等,区块链开发涉及到以下技术要点:
1、密码学:区块链技术采用密码学原理,如哈希算法、椭圆曲线加密等,确保数据安全和隐私保护。
2、共识算法:区块链网络中的节点需要通过共识算法来达成一致,以确保网络的安全和稳定,常见的共识算法有工作量证明(PoW)、权益证明(PoS)等。
3、智能合约:智能合约是一种自动执行、自动监管的合约,它允许在区块链上进行编程,实现自定义的业务逻辑。
4、去中心化存储:区块链采用分布式存储技术,将数据分散存储在各个节点上,提高数据的安全性和可靠性。
5、跨链技术:为了实现不同区块链之间的互操作性,开发者需要研究跨链技术,以实现数据和价值在不同区块链之间的传递。
区块链开发具有以下特点:
1、开放性:区块链技术是开源的,任何人都可以参与到区块链的开发和创新中。
2、去中心化:区块链应用摒弃了传统的中心化架构,降低了单点故障的风险,提高了系统的稳定性和抗攻击能力。
3、安全性:区块链采用密码学原理,确保数据安全和用户隐私。
4、高效性:区块链技术可以实现自动化执行和智能合约,提高业务处理效率。
5、降低成本:去中心化的特点使得区块链技术可以降低传统业务中的中介成本。
区块链技术作为一种新兴的技术,正逐步改变着我们的生活,通过了解区块链技术及其开发,我们可以更好地把握这一技术趋势,为自己的未来创造更多可能,从开户参与区块链,到深入研究区块链开发,每一个步骤都需要我们不断学习和探索,让我们一起拥抱区块链,迎接新时代的到来。